Description

16 digital inputsSink circuit2 counter inputs with 40 kHz counter frequencyABR incremental encoderPeriod duration / gate time measurement16 mixed channels optionally as input or outputSource circuitIntegrated output protection3 PWM outputsAll channels with 1-wire connections

The module is equipped with 16 inputs and 16 mixed channels, optionally as input or output in 1-wire technology. The outputs are designed for a source output circuit, and the inputs are designed for a sink circuit.
